I have always imported my new photos & videos (saved to "Cameral Roll" Album)

From "Photos" app on iPad (3rd gen) Wi-Fi + Cellular (VZ), iOS 6

To "iPhoto" app on MacBook Pro, OS X Mountain Lion (10.8.2), 13-inch. Mid2010. 2.4 GHz Intel Core 2 Duo

Via USB (not wi-fi)

A few days ago I imported "selected" photos & videos, as usual, no problem…

The following day I attempted to import of one remaining video, recorded with iPad "Camera" and saved to "Photos" "Camera Roll" Album but received the following message:

"Error downloading image.

iPhoto cannot import your photos because there was a problem downloading an image."

I have attempted the following alternatives (which all generated the same message):


  • restarting all devices
  • importing to iMovie app
  • importing to Preview app
Using iTunes, as of "Today at 1:13pm," I completed a Sync with preferences "Backups: Automatically Back Up — This computer: A full backup of your iPad will be stored on this computer."


However, I have NOT updated the latest iOS 6.0.1 yet; as I was unsure if this would jeopardize the chances of retrieving (along with the fear of possibly losing) this very important educational video recording (duration - 1 hour: 03minutes: 30seconds).

If you plug your iPad in to the Mac can the "Image Capture" application see the pictures and vieos? You may be able to import the video using this utility. Or you may see the same message or maybe even a different message.
